Bautista takes commanding Race 2 win in San Juan

The Championship chief is one race nearer to the title with a 82-point lead and two rounds to go

 

Alvaro Bautista (19). Picture courtesy Dorna.

 

Race 2 highlights – WorldSBK

P1 – Alvaro Bautista (Aruba.it Racing – Ducati)

Bautista claimed his second win of the weekend in Race 2. He had a 3.389s hole to Razgatlioglu.

He prolonged his lead within the Championship standings to 82 factors over Razgatlioglu and can have a primary likelihood to win the title subsequent day out on the Pirelli Indonesian Spherical.

Bautista might declare the title within the subsequent race if he outscores Razgatlioglu by 17 factors and Rea by one level.

P2 – Toprak Razgatlioglu (Pata Yamaha with Brixx WorldSBK)

Razgatlioglu was second in Race 2 ending 9.764s forward of Rea.

He stays second within the Championship standings with 425 factors.

P3 – Jonathan Rea (Kawasaki Racing Workforce WorldSBK)

After battling along with his teammate for third place within the closing levels of the race, Rea made the transfer at Flip 8 on Lap 18 to take one other podium end.

Rea stands in third place within the Championship standings, 98 factors behind Bautista and 16 factors behind Razgatlioglu.

To notice:

Baz battled again from the rear of the sphere after he got here off his bike following a Lap 2 collision with Axel Bassani (Motocorsa Racing) at Flip 12. The incident was investigated by the FIM WorldSBK Stewards with Bassani deemed at fault, with the Italian penalised with a Lengthy Lap Penalty. Nevertheless, for not taking this in time, Bassani was given a second Lengthy Lap Penalty earlier than he was given a journey by penalty for not taking his Lengthy Lap Penalties on time.

The Pirelli Indonesian Spherical will happen from the eleventh to the thirteenth of November at the Pertamina Mandalika Worldwide Avenue Circuit.
